Output 21cb74f4eeddc607f224667ce23e6229a0e614e393c47227976fec21d8df01f0:1

value
190141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ce15dc28c2e0a0723f437225e15941e0ae49bec1 OP_EQUAL
address
3LUhJvKFuG1yJPzP56xXKTi5L8mU9HCimL
transaction
21cb74f4eeddc607f224667ce23e6229a0e614e393c47227976fec21d8df01f0
confirmations
256817
spent
true